WebRinse the wild rice in cold water. Add it to broth or water in a saucepan. Bring to a boil. As soon as it begins to boil, reduce heat to low, cover, and let simmer for 15-20 minutes. While the rice cooks, sauté the mushrooms and onion in butter in a dutch oven or stock pot over medium-high heat. Wild rice, contrary to the name, is not actually a member of the rice family, although it is a grain producing grass. Native to North America, this grain can still be found growing wild in the ponds and lakes of Wisconsin, as well as in neighboring states.
